Sat 769040948432849

decimal
153808.948432849
degree
0°153808′592″948432849‴
percentile
36.6209975847045%
name
ikclyeewbpo
cycle
0
epoch
0
period
76
block
153808
offset
948432849
timestamp
rarity
common